Job description
The Business Development Manager is responsible for identifying new business opportunities, building and nurturing client relationships, and driving revenue growth. This role focuses on developing strategic partnerships, creating customized solutions for clients, and expanding the company’s presence in the logistics, warehousing, and freight forwarding industry.
Key Responsibilities
- Develop and implement business development strategies to achieve sales targets and revenue growth.
- Identify, research, and pursue new business opportunities in existing and emerging markets.
- Build and maintain strong client relationships through effective communication and regular engagement.
- Prepare and deliver sales presentations, proposals, and contract negotiations.
- Collaborate with internal teams (operations, customer service, finance) to ensure seamless client onboarding and service delivery.
- Conduct market research to stay updated on industry trends, competitors, and customer needs.
- Represent the company at networking events, trade shows, and industry conferences.
- Monitor and analyze sales performance metrics, providing regular reports and recommendations to management.
- Lead, mentor, and support junior sales and business development staff (if applicable).
